波普尔式提示技能在结构之外对编码没有益处

一项新研究调查了“波普尔式”提示技能在改进AI代码生成方面的有效性。研究人员发现,虽然结构化提示或脚手架确实提高了小型模型的代码正确性,但该技能的特定波普尔式推理部分没有提供额外的好处。研究表明,提示的结构元素,而不是其特定的推理指令,是代码生成改进的主要原因。 AI

影响 这项研究表明,在代码生成方面,提示工程的收益可能更多地在于结构性脚手架,而不是特定的推理技术,这可能指导未来的提示优化工作。
